RESUMO
OBJECTIVE: To identify exposure factors contributing to lead poisoning in school children from Mexico City. MATERIAL AND METHODS: Cross-sectional study of 340 children. A convenience sample of schools and a random sample of children were selected. A questionnaire was filled out and venous blood samples were taken. Lead levels were measured by atomic absorption spectrophotometry. Statistical analysis consisted of comparison of means using Student's t test and ANOVA. Multiple linear regression was used for multivariate analysis. Logarithmic transformation of lead blood levels were used to account for their non-normal distribution. RESULTS: Geometric means for private and public schools were: GM = 8.76 micrograms/dl, 95% CI = 9.1-10.5; GM = 11.5 micrograms/dl, 95% CI = 9.4-13.5. Lead levels were higher among children from public schools who are male, between 6 and 8 years of age, in first and second grade, whose mothers have a profession, who use glazed earthenware utensils, and who live near glazed earthenware shops or factories. CONCLUSIONS: Exposure predictors of lead blood levels are: being between 6 and 8 years of age, having a professional mother, using glazed earthenware utensils, living near glazed earthenware shops or factories, and studying the second grade of elementary school.

Epidemiological and health system research projects are often delayed due to the difficulties to build validated data basis in personal computers. This papers presents a new computer interactive program for handling numeric data from a given questionnaire to a structured archive. The questionnaire includes the basic variables of the dwelling and of the members of the household. A list of sociodemographic and health variables are selected, although other variables can be easily added, according to special needs. All the intermediate steps regularly needed to construct a data base are included in the package: capture, verification, validation and record linkage. The package is equipped with the basic procedures needed to produce tabulations and basic statistical analysis.
